Remanded (sent back)

The Board remanded the claim for service connection of diabetes to obtain a VA medical opinion that fully complies with previous remand instructions.

The deciding factor: The August 2024 VA medical opinion was found inadequate because it did not sufficiently address the Veteran's statements and provided medical literature regarding the relationship between rheumatoid arthritis and diabetes.
